Having kicked off 2015 all guns blazing, Mojo Juju looks set to see the year out in true cowboy style, riding off into the sunset. With two singles and an album all released in the first 4 months of the year, (not to mention the release of German film ‘Bestefreunde’, the soundtrack comprised entirely from Mojo Juju’s back catalogue.) All of this followed by a huge national tour with a full band, one would think Juju would be starting to slow down a little. However it seems that she is not quite done yet, keen to get up close and personal with her audience she is planning a run of ‘stripped back & intimate’ shows to round up the year. There will indeed be some festival appearances with the full band, but for the most part Juju will be keeping it as raw and personal as possible.
Teaming up with her long time collaborator, some times co-writer and real life sibling, Steven ‘T-Bone’ Ruiz de Luzuriaga (Drums/percussion), the two will perform new material which is yet to be recorded, along with a selection from Mojo’s two solo albums and two albums from their previous band ‘The Snake Oil Merchants’. These are shows focused around the songwriting and the storytelling, the vocals and the mood
The siblings have headlined tours as a duo in Australia & Europe, supported acts such as Swamp Blues legend Tony Joe White (USA) and RnB singer Nick Waterhouse (USA), and featured at an impressive list of Australian Music Festivals.
